LUCKNOW, India - A 23-year-old rape victim was set ablaze by a gang of men, including the alleged rapist, as she made her way to court in Uttar Pradesh's Unnao district on Thursday, police said, stirring public outrage and shame over the scourge of crimes against women.
Protesters and parliamentarians are pressing for courts to fast-track rape cases and demanding tougher penalties. She had been on her way to catch a train in Unnao district to attend a hearing when she was doused with kerosene and set on fire, police said. Having been subsequently jailed, the alleged rapist was released last week after securing bail, police officer S.K. Bhagat said in Lucknow.
